(a) Effective October 1, 1988, the county salary supplement of the circuit judges of Morgan County, Alabama, shall be an amount equal to 40 percent of the prevailing salary paid to such judges by the state. Such supplement shall be paid in lieu of all other supplemental or expense payments heretofore authorized by law.

(b) The provisions of this section are not amendable except by local act and specifically shall not be amended by any act of general legislation without a specific reference to this section in such general legislation therein setting out in full the provisions or parts of this section to be amended. Any general legislation that does not comply with this section shall in no way effect a revision nor amendment to this section in whole or in part.
(c) This section shall have a retroactive effective to October 1, 1988.
